How safe is Cantley?
Cantley has a high crime rate for an East of England village, with around 51 recorded crimes per 1,000 people a year. This is 31% below the national average, and 12% below the Norfolk average. The rate is adjusted for visitor and workday population. The comparison is stabilised for a small population.

What are the demographics of Cantley?
The majority of residents in Cantley identify as White (British) (97%). Most residents were born in the United Kingdom (97%). The area has a mix of religious beliefs with no single faith forming a majority.
